I've been meaning to get the Rustler back in operational condition, and so I said, what the heck, I'll go straight for the 10-cell setup I've been wanting to try for so long. 6-cell is standard.

There are a total of 14 cells in this pic! Because 12 volts is too much for the receiver to receive power from the ESC, I needed a separate battery-pack to power it. Luckily I had a 4-AA holder left over from my electrical engineering course.
For the main battery pack, basically I just wired a cheap 6-cell 1500 stick pack with a 4-cell 1500 stick pack. The 4-cell is a chopped-up 6-cell, and that was the only soldering I had to do for the entire thing :D

I use Duratrax/Andersen Powerpole connectors, which have a low resistance compared to the typical "tamiya" connector, but they're very unpopular nowadays compared to deans and traxxas connectors. However, you can't do this with deans or traxxas:

I just turned two battery packs into one! And its reversible! This is made possible because the Powerpole plug is modular, and more importantly, has no gender (or is it hermaphroditic? who cares). I don't know about the current carrying characteristics (o.o alliteration) when comparing the three types of plugs, because the Traxxas one is relatively new and I've seen the contact plates, they're pretty big, but for my brushed-motor, NiCd application the 'poles are super. I'm glad I switched so many years ago.

Speaking of batteries, I finally made a discharger so I could perform battery maintenance better. The local electronics shop had the standard automotive 1157 bulbs for $1 for two. I bought out their 6, and made a 6-bulb, 12-amp discharger. The closest automotive parts store wanted $2 each, so I didn't opt for the full, standard 10-bulb discharger. So the total cost was pretty much the $3.50 for the 6 bulbs, since I had some old 12-gauge laying around, and I have a bunch of the powerpole plugs.
construction
The finished discharger.
The discharger in action (it got a LOT brighter with my 6-cell sidexside NiMHs, saying a lot about the performance of shotgun-style construction, which is shown in the picture).

The bulbs get blindingly-bright (with the NiMHs) and really hot. Each one draws 2 amps at 7 volts!
